Technology and the human future: Will AI surpass human intelligence
The specter of artificial intelligence (AI) surpassing human intelligence looms large in the public imagination, painting visions of robotic overlords or utopian problem-solvers. While AI's rise is undeniable, predicting its ultimate impact on humanity requires nuanced understanding beyond simplistic dominance narratives. AI's current prowess lies in brute-force calculations and pattern recognition. It can churn through data mountains, excel at games like chess, and even generate convincing text. Yet, it stumbles in domains requiring commonsense reasoning, emotional intelligence, and the ability to navigate real-world complexities. We laugh, cry, feel empathy, and adapt to unexpected situations – capabilities largely outside AI's current grasp.
Instead of fearing a clear-cut AI takeover, a more realistic future envisions synergy and collaboration. Imagine AI handling data-heavy tasks, freeing humans to focus on creativity, critical thinking, and social interaction. Doctors could utilize AI for early disease detection, artists could collaborate with AI for unique art forms, and engineers could leverage AI for complex simulations. This augmented intelligence model, where humans and AI complement each other, holds immense potential. However, this path requires navigating ethical and societal challenges. Responsible AI development that prioritizes fairness, transparency, and human oversight is crucial. Education systems need to equip individuals with the skills to thrive in an AI-driven world, fostering critical thinking, adaptability, and collaboration alongside technical know-how. Ethical considerations around data privacy, job displacement, and potential biases in AI algorithms demand proactive discussions and regulations.
